Family friendly things to do in Laidley

Laidley, Queensland, is a delightful small town that offers a range of family-friendly activities sure to create lasting memories. Start your adventure at the Laidley Pioneer Village and Museum, where children can explore a fascinating collection of historical buildings and artefacts, providing a glimpse into the past that is both educational and engaging. Just a short drive away, the beautiful Laidley Creek offers a perfect picnic spot, where families can enjoy a leisurely day out, complete with walking trails and opportunities for birdwatching amidst stunning natural surroundings. Don’t miss the chance to visit the Laidley Golf Club; with its welcoming atmosphere, it invites families to play a round together or enjoy the scenic views while having a bite to eat at the clubhouse. For a fun-filled day, head to the local skate park, which features ramps and equipment suitable for all skill levels, encouraging kids to be active and adventurous. Finally, the Laidley Showgrounds often host events such as markets and agricultural shows, providing a vibrant community spirit that families can immerse themselves in. When's the best time to book a family-friendly holiday in Laidley?
The hottest months are usually January and December, with an average temperature of 24°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 15°C. Average annual precipitation for Laidley is 906 mm.
What's there to see and do with your family in Laidley?
While you and your family are visiting Laidley, you may want to explore some child-friendly attractions such as Hidden Vale Adventure Park, Bowman Park Koala Nature Refuge and Old Hiddenvale Nature Refuge. Make sure that you have lots of time for activities such as Jensens Swamp Environmental Reserve and Mount Stradbroke Nature Refuge.
